Vanguard's CIO Buckley to become CEO as McNabb steps down in 2018

McNabb to remain as chairman

The board of the Vanguard Group has announced CIO Tim Buckley will become the firm's fourth CEO since it was founded in 1975, as Bill McNabb steps down as chief executive next year.

McNabb, who joined Vanguard in 1986, has been chief executive since 2008 and will remain as chairman of the board. There will be a six-month transition period with Buckley taking over on 1 January 2018. Buckley has worked as chief investment officer at the firm since 2013, a role that involves responsibility for $3.8trn of assets. As part of the move, Buckley has also been appointed president and director of the firm.
